First, let's understand what a flat burr grinder is and how it works. A flat burr grinder is a type of coffee grinder that uses two flat, parallel burrs to grind the coffee beans. The beans are ground between the two burrs, which can be adjusted to achieve a specific grind size. This results in a more consistent grind than other types of grinders, such as blade grinders or conical burr grinders.
One of the main benefits of a flat burr grinder is its ability to produce a uniform grind size. This is important because a consistent grind size is one of the key factors in brewing a great cup of coffee. When the coffee beans are ground to a uniform size, the extraction of flavor is even, resulting in a balanced and flavorful cup of coffee. In addition, a flat burr grinder produces less heat during the grinding process, which can help preserve the delicate flavors of the coffee beans.
Another important aspect of a flat burr grinder is its versatility. These grinders offer a wide range of grind settings, allowing you to achieve the perfect grind for any brewing method, from espresso to French press. This versatility makes a flat burr grinder a great choice for both home and commercial use, as it can accommodate the diverse needs of different coffee drinkers.

Mazzer is an Italian company that has been manufacturing coffee grinders since the 1950s. Their grinders are known for their durability, precision, and reliability, making them a popular choice among coffee professionals around the world.
When it comes to choosing a Mazzer burr grinder, there are several factors to consider, including the size of the grinder, the type of burrs, and the motor power. Mazzer offers a range of models to cater to different needs, from home use to commercial settings. Let's take a closer look at some of their popular models and compare their features.
One of the most popular models in the Mazzer line-up is the Mazzer Mini. This compact grinder is perfect for home use or small cafes. It features 58mm flat burrs and a powerful motor that delivers consistent and uniform grinds. The Mazzer Mini is also known for its durability and user-friendly design, making it a great choice for those who are new to espresso brewing.
Moving up the Mazzer range, we have the Mazzer Super Jolly. This grinder is a favorite among professional baristas due to its larger burrs (64mm) and higher grinding capacity. The Super Jolly is designed to meet the demands of high-volume coffee shops, delivering precise and fast grinding while maintaining a quiet operation. Its doserless design and stepless grind adjustment also make it a versatile choice for those who are particular about their coffee brewing.
For those who are looking for a commercial-grade grinder, the Mazzer Major is worth considering. With 83mm flat burrs and a powerful motor, the Major is capable of handling large quantities of coffee with ease. It is designed for heavy-duty use and can deliver consistent grinds for extended periods. The Major also features a stepless micrometrical grind adjustment system, allowing baristas to fine-tune their grind settings to achieve the perfect extraction.

To begin, it is important to understand the basic principles behind the operation of flat burr grinders. Unlike blade grinders, which rely on sharp blades to chop and shred coffee beans, flat burr grinders use two flat discs with sharp ridges to crush and grind the beans. The distance between the discs can be adjusted to control the fineness of the grind, resulting in a more precise and consistent grind size.
One of the primary advantages of flat burr grinders is their ability to produce a uniform grind size, which is essential for achieving a balanced and flavorful cup of coffee. The consistent particle size ensures that the coffee grounds are extracted evenly during the brewing process, resulting in a more even extraction and a better-tasting coffee. This is particularly important for brewing methods such as espresso, where a consistent grind is crucial for achieving the proper extraction and crema.
Another advantage of flat burr grinders is their ability to maintain the freshness and flavor of the coffee beans. Because the grind size is consistent, the coffee grounds are exposed to the same level of extraction, allowing for a more controlled and even extraction process. This results in a more uniform flavor profile and a more balanced cup of coffee. Additionally, the low-heat, low-speed grinding process of flat burr grinders helps to preserve the natural oils and flavors of the coffee beans, resulting in a more aromatic and flavorful brew.
When compared to conical burr grinders, flat burr grinders are often preferred for their ability to produce a more uniform grind and a higher level of control over the grind size. The flat discs of a flat burr grinder tend to create a flatter, more uniform particle size distribution, whereas conical burr grinders may produce a wider range of particle sizes due to the cone-shaped burrs. This makes flat burr grinders particularly well-suited for brewing methods that require a consistent and precise grind, such as espresso and pour-over.

A coffee grinder burr is a small, toothed wheel made of ceramic or stainless steel that is responsible for grinding the coffee beans into fine particles. The two burrs are positioned inside the grinder and when they rotate against each other, they crush the coffee beans to the desired consistency. This process is crucial in determining the flavor, aroma, and overall quality of the coffee.
One of the most significant advantages of using a burr grinder over a blade grinder is the consistency of the grind. A burr grinder produces uniform particles of coffee, which is essential for extracting the full flavor from the grounds. On the other hand, a blade grinder can result in uneven particle sizes, leading to an inconsistent extraction and ultimately, a less flavorful cup of coffee.
In addition to consistency, a coffee grinder burr also allows for greater control over the fineness of the grind. With the ability to adjust the distance between the burrs, you can easily customize the grind size to suit your brewing method. Whether you prefer a coarse grind for a French press or a fine grind for espresso, a burr grinder provides the versatility to achieve the perfect grind for your desired coffee beverage.
Furthermore, the design of a burr grinder ensures minimal heat buildup during the grinding process. This is important as excessive heat can alter the flavor and aroma of the coffee. By minimizing heat generation, a burr grinder preserves the natural oils and flavors of the coffee beans, resulting in a superior tasting brew.

The first step to maintaining your coffee grinder burr is to clean it regularly. Over time, coffee oils and particles can build up and affect the flavor of your coffee. To clean your grinder burr, start by unplugging the machine and removing the hopper and burr. Use a brush or a toothpick to remove any stuck-on particles and then wash the burrs with warm, soapy water. Be sure to dry them thoroughly before reassembling the grinder.
In addition to regular cleaning, it’s important to keep your coffee grinder burr properly calibrated. This ensures that the burrs are properly aligned and the grind size is consistent. Most grinders come with a calibration tool or a knob that allows you to adjust the grind size. It’s a good idea to check and adjust the calibration periodically to ensure that your grinder is always delivering the perfect grind for your brewing method.
